Outpost on the Zumwalt
Join a small group of writers and unplug for a week, be inspired by nature, and have the time and support to write about it. Fishtrap’s Outpost on the Zumwalt Prairie connects you with a cohort of creative writers and an experienced instructor to help guide you on your writing journey.
Author and educator CMarie Fuhrman leads the 2026 program, supported by biologist Janet Hohmann, to create an experience that uncovers new ways to interpret and interact with the natural world.
Outpost takes place on The Nature Conservancy Zumwalt Prairie Preserve, a 33,000 acre grassland in rural Wallowa County, Oregon. Instructor CMarie Fuhrman will guide workshop participants to explore new ways to invigorate your writing through discovery of the natural world.
